CereCore is seeking a Senior .NET Developer to join our hybrid team in Nashville, TN.
Summary: This position is a senior .NET developer position who will report directly to the Manager of Supply Chain Platform Development at HealthTrust. A successful candidate will demonstrate an understanding of software patterns, software modeling, secure programming principles, test-driven development or another unit testing methodology, and code standards compliance. In addition, this candidate will have a history of increasing responsibility in a small multi-role team. This position requires a candidate who can analyze business requirements, perform design tasks, construct, test, and implement solutions with minimal supervision. This candidate will have a track record of participation in successful projects in a fast-paced, mixed team (consultant and employee) environment. In addition, the applicant must be willing to mentor other developers to prepare them for assuming the responsibilities of a Senior Software Engineer. The Senior Software Engineer will be required to learn about existing legacy systems and provide on-going technical support for both existing and new applications. The applicant will provide second-level support for existing applications within a group. The Senior Software Engineer must be a highly motivated self-starter, an enthusiastic learner, and must be committed to delivering high quality solutions within scheduled timelines.
Responsibilities:
Closely collaborates with team members to successfully execute development initiatives using Agile practices and principles
Leads efforts to design, development, deploy, and support software systems
Integrates new/existing software with existing systems
Collaborates with business analysts, project lead, management and customers on requirements
Participates in large-scale development projects involving multiple areas outside of core team
Designs fit-for-purpose products to ensure products align to the customer's strategic plans and technology road maps
Demonstrates and coaches value-based decision making and Agile principles across teams
Coaches team on existing system structure, constraints and deficiencies with product
Shares knowledge and experience to contribute to growth of overall team capabilities
Focuses on customer satisfaction
Rapidly prototypes and delivers just-in-time solutions
Gather requirements, designs, constructs and delivers solutions with minimal team interaction
Works in an environment with rapidly changing business requirements and priorities
Act as a leader to the teams’ continuous integration and continuous delivery automation pipeline
Requirements:
Full Stack developer with a wide range of experience
Demonstration of, and belief in the Agile mindset.
Experience with CI/CD, TDD, Angular, HTML5, CSS3, Web API, REST, micro services, .NET core framework and GitHub strongly preferred.
5+ years of engineering, delivering and supporting production software products required.
5+ years working with object-oriented design, SQL, and web programming required.
Delivery of past software systems with documented value required.
Strong focus on delivering customer value required.
Excellent troubleshooting, analysis, and problem-solving abilities required.
Ability to engineer and build software through multiple languages and tools required.
Strong verbal and written communication with the ability to work with staff and business required.
Experience with Agile/Kanban, Scrum and Domain Driven Design preferred.
Willingness to learn our business domain required.
Experience with standard change management process.
Experience with continuous integration and continuous deployment preferred.
Experience managing web applications hosted on IIS
Experience managing web applications hosted in cloud-based platforms (PaaS)
Experience with OAuth/OpenID Connect preferred
Experience with NuGet package design/creation
Experience with messaging systems
Experience with application monitoring, i.e., AppInsights.
Experience with Xamarin preferred
CereCore was formed in 2001 as a shared service business within a large hospital operator. We focus solely on helping healthcare organizations align business and IT strategies to improve processes and patient care. Awards and Recognition
Modern Healthcare selected CereCore as one of the 2020 "Best Places to Work in Healthcare."
CereCore wins ClearlyRated's 2020 and 2021 "Best of Staffing" Client and Talent Awards for Service Excellence.
HCA Workplace Measures Up & Earns Computerworld 2017 "Best Places to Work in IT Award," an award we’ve earned since 2009.
HCA has been named a Military Friendly® Employer for the eighth year in a row. We're proud to hire and support our nation's veterans – and proud of our employees.
Our Commitment to Diversity and Inclusion We believe excellence in healthcare starts with a foundation of inclusion, compassion and respect for our patients and each other. We are committed to fostering a culture of inclusion across all areas of our organization. We are an equal opportunity employer and we value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.